Norovirus strain types found within the second infectious intestinal diseases (IID2) study an analysis of norovirus circulating in the community

Abstract: BackgroundNorovirus is the commonest cause of infectious intestinal disease (IID) worldwide. In the UK community incidence of norovirus has been estimated at 59/1000 population, equating to four million cases a year. Whilst norovirus infects people… read more here.
